State Judicial Clerkship The Honorable Judge Jay B. McCallum The candidate must have excellent academic grades. The one-year clerkship begins in the Fall following graduation and may be extended. Should apply directly to individual district court judge. The deadlines vary, but students should begin applying during 2L year and confirm with the individual judge.
Send resume, cover letter, 2 letters of recommendation, unofficial law school transcript, and writing sample. Judges Link: http://ldja.org/judges/6th-district/
